Are you sure it's not just the switch - they are notorious for being tempramental, can you get the blower to come on by pushing it down hard? Just a thought before you get all your dash etc off!
 
My heater has blown the fuse, now not working. Looks like taking the heater box out? can you buy the resister?
 
Hi as suggested I would confirm the switch is working, unplug the connector on the fan housing, connect in a new fuse and switch on the fan, fuse still ok? Check the connector for voltage, if everything is ok connect the fan wiring plug, if the fuse blows start looking at the fan motor assy.
I hope this helps :)
 
Just done mine on the 110, blower motor siezed, fitted new motor and after market air vent cover to the wing to try and prevent water getting in again, problems i came across were rebuilding the perished seal between the box and bulk head, couple of rounded/snapped 10mm nuts and tight space to remove heater box assembly, just enough to do so without removing the wing though.
